Pinewood BI provides profit-boosting insights

Dealers have the tools to be smarter than ever in their business decisions. When Pinewood launched their Business Intelligence (BI), it gave dealers the potential to look beyond the standard DMS reports, bringing new insights to light. Leaders can access live data in seconds from their mobile, delving into every area of the business in just a few clicks, from anywhere worldwide. It’s never been easier.

After launching BI for Porsche Norway, Stine Hagen, Corporate Business Development Manager, explained how the mobile intelligence tool delivered immediate results: “Leaders went from spending hours on KPI reports to having them live on their computer and phone at all times. This is an excellent tool for all leaders to see what part of the dealership needs their attention in a hectic everyday life.”

From struggling sales teams to inefficient workshops, Pinewood BI can help identify why businesses are falling behind, highlighting areas of concern and indicating where productivity can be improved. Fully integrated with Pinewood DMS, Pinewood BI acts as a ‘behind the scenes’ detective, interpreting real-time data through easy-to-understand, visual reports. Even away from the dealership, leaders can maintain full visibility and control, accessing the entire reporting suite from their mobile – giving them a huge competitive advantage.

Hagen explains: We strive to give the best value and service for our customers, which can only be achieved through complete internal transparency and process control. Pinewood has given us the perfect tool to monitor and steer all aspects, from trade-ins to car sales, service and used cars. Combined with the financial capabilities of the system, we’ve reached new levels of process excellence.”

BI is available for any dealer groups using Pinewood DMS, offering a powerful tool for building profit and productivity-focused reports, fully accessible on a PC or mobile device. This brings the data dealers want to their fingertips, anywhere at any time, providing full transparency.

Pinewood Sponsors Birmingham Open Hack 2020

Pinewood Technologies proudly sponsored the Birmingham Open Hack event which took place this weekend, challenging students from Birmingham City University to an online hackathon. Students put their technical skills to the test in a competitive 48-hour online challenge, with other major sponsors including IBM, Santander and Microsoft. Pinewood were impressed by the passion, commitment and technical skills displayed, Katrina McTernan, Early Careers Recruiter at Pinewood explains:

“It was inspiring to see such energy from the next generation of our tech community – these students have set the benchmark, giving us a clear picture of the level of talent we can expect to be joining our teams in the near future.”

Pinewood’s challenge was to develop a Microsoft Teams Bot for remote classrooms, allowing teachers to create flash cards and questions to present to students, returning results back to the teacher. Pinewood were impressed by efforts from all candidates, viewing the hackathon with fantastic potential to bring new talent into their software teams. Katrina discusses:

“We invest a lot in early careers, hiring up to 20 Computer Science Graduates and Undergraduates each year to grow the best talent. Being involved in events like Birmingham Open Hack allows us to scout out new talent, it’s great to see so many students showing an interest in development beyond their course of study.”

Pinewood offer remote training and implementation to dealers

2020 has been the year of change with dealers now exploring new ways to engage with their customers and boost profits. Pinewood have offered online coaching for some years, but take-up has grown hugely since the lockdown. This coaching is aimed at helping dealers remodel their business and get the best from their digital tools. All of this can be offered more cheaply than the fuel normally needed to attend a traditional classroom course. Mike Browne, International Account Manager at Pinewood explains how the online implementation proved a success:

“The remote implementation was one of the smoothest we’ve had. With eLearning, the staff could become familiar with the parts of the system related to their job roles, using real examples. During Live Week, everyone was prepared and ready to go. We used Microsoft Teams to manage any queries and held regular video calls to answer any detailed questions they had. Screen sharing and tracking their progress on Teams made everything so easy – just as, if not more, effective as being there in person.”

Online training allows Pinewood users to access courses designed specifically for their job roles – on desktops, tablets and mobile phones. Ranging from showroom courses for salespeople, to workshop courses for technicians, eLearning is a simpler, more effective way to learn about Pinewood DMS.

This new training initiative gained immediate traction with a clear demand from dealers for convenient, cost-effective training which did not disrupt everyday business. Pinewood wins DMS award at Car Dealer Power 2020

Pinewood DMS was announced as the overall winner for Dealer Management System of the year, at the virtual Car Dealer Power Awards 2020. Finalists were voted for by thousands of dealerships across the UK.

“Thanks so much to all of our Pinewood customers who voted for us. Our team are absolutely thrilled, it’s been a tough year for everyone and we’re glad that we’ve managed to support our customers through this time.” Says Neville Briggs, Managing Director for Pinewood.

Pinewood has improved on their zero-touch features over the past few months, with some great feedback from customers. For example; Online Service Booking, Remote document signing (Workshop Jobs & Vehicle Sales Orders), Online payments of Workshop Invoices, Voice Controlled Technician app.

To support dealers with adopting new tools, Pinewood’s Support team are available 7 days a week. The eLearning platform also provides role-based courses, making sure customers are using the system in the best way possible.
